Name and origin of the protein
Protein name Pyridoxal kinase
Synonyms EC 2.7.1.35
Pyridoxine kinase
Gene name
PDXK or PKH or PNK
From
Homo sapiens (Human) [TaxID: 9606]
Taxonomy Eukaryota; Metazoa; Chordata; Craniata; Vertebrata; Euteleostomi; Mammalia; Eutheria; Primates; Catarrhini; Hominidae; Homo.
